1. Preserving Financial Stability:

Life insurance serves as a crucial tool in maintaining financial stability for individuals and families in the face of unforeseen events. According to an Insurance Barometer Study conducted by LIMRA and Life Hap pens, 63% of Americans admitted they would experience financial diffi culties within six months if the primary breadwinner were to pass away unexpectedly. Life insurance safeguards against this risk by providing a death benefit to cover funeral expenses, debt repayments, mortgage payments, and college education for dependents.

2. Mitigating Income Loss:

In the event of the sudden loss of a breadwinner, life insurance acts as a safety net to replace the income previously provided. A study conducted by the Federal Reserve found that close to 30% of families experience a substantial decline in income after the death of a wage earner. Life insurance ensures that dependents are not left without adequate financial support, enabling them to maintain their quality of life and meet ongoing expenses.

3. Legacy and Estate Planning:

Life insurance plays a pivotal role in securing an individual's legacy and acting as an essential component of estate planning. It allows one to plan for the smooth transfer of assets to beneficiaries. A study by the Life Foundation discovered that 60% of Americans favor life insurance as a means of leaving an inheritance. By designating beneficiaries, policyholders can guarantee their loved ones' financial security, preserving their legacies and providing for future generations.

4. Peace of Mind and Emotional Well-being:

Knowing that loved ones will be financially protected in the event of one's demise brings substantial peace of mind. This emotional security allows individuals to live their lives without constant worry about the future. A survey conducted by Genworth found that 78% of individuals who purchased life insurance experienced peace of mind regarding their family's financial well-being. Life insurance provides the assurance that loved ones can carry on without financial strain and focus on emotional healing.
